Charlie Brown hosts a Thanksgiving feast that spirals into chaos when Peppermint Patty and her friends turn up demanding a turkey. With only cereal and toast on hand, Charlie seems doomed, but Linus, Snoopy and Woodstock rally to save the day. Amid turkey, cranberry sauce and pumpkin pie, the Peanuts gang shows why gratitude and friendship make the holiday truly special.

The story takes place in Charlie Brown's suburban neighborhood, with key scenes at his house, his grandmother's house, and Snoopy's doghouse. The setting also includes a modern condominium, reflecting an urban environment within a peaceful community typical of American residential areas.
The movie is set during the Thanksgiving holiday season, reflecting contemporary American customs and traditions. This timing anchors the story in the familiar cultural context of family gatherings, gratitude, and festive meals.
The movie centers on Thanksgiving themes of gratitude, friendship, and community. It showcases the importance of sharing and understanding, even when traditions don't go as planned, and explores the value of kindness and apologies in maintaining relationships.
Friendship is a core theme demonstrated through the characters' efforts to include each other in holiday festivities. It emphasizes acceptance, forgiveness, and the joy of togetherness, especially when plans don't turn out perfectly. The characters learn that true friendship means welcoming others even during stressful situations.
The key characters include Charlie Brown, the kind-hearted and earnest host; Peppermint Patty, the confident and outspoken friend; Linus, the thoughtful and spiritual character who leads a prayer; Snoopy, the imaginative dog who adds humor; and Woodstock, Snoopy's loyal bird companion.
Linus serves as the thoughtful, spiritual presence who guides the group with his prayer reflecting belief in gratitude and tradition. He emphasizes the deeper meaning of Thanksgiving and fosters a sense of unity among the friends, acting as a moral compass throughout the gathering.
Peppermint Patty is portrayed as confident and outspoken, sometimes impatient but well-meaning. Her initial frustration over the lack of traditional food highlights her high expectations for the holiday, and she learns about understanding and friendship through the experience.
Snoopy and Woodstock share a loyal companionship typical of the Peanuts universe. Woodstock is Snoopy's devoted bird companion who shares in holiday festivities, and their interaction over the wishbone symbolizes friendship and good fortune, adding humor to traditional holiday themes.
The suburban neighborhood setting reflects a typical peaceful American community where social gatherings naturally occur. It creates an intimate, relatable backdrop that emphasizes the accessibility of holiday celebration and community spirit, reinforcing the movie's message that warmth and friendship matter more than elaborate preparations.
Thanksgiving symbolizes more than just a holiday meal, it represents gratitude, togetherness, and the true spirit of inclusion. The movie conveys that the holiday's meaning comes from sharing with friends and family, not from having perfect traditions or elaborate food.
